We meandered along to the town of Othello and entered the Columbia National Wildlife Reserve.

Almost immediately we were greeted by hosts of blackbirds, the most stunning of which were the beautiful Yellow-headed Blackbirds. There were many of them in the reeds and cattails which bordered the small lakes beside the road, and they sang along with their Red-winged cousins.
